Alzheimer’s treatment may lie in the brain’s cleanup crew 🧠 For decades, scientists have worked to stop Alzheimer’s disease by removing amyloid beta plaques. Now, a Northwestern Medicine study finds the brain’s own immune cells can clear them more effectively.
